6 Off-the-Grid Getaways to Unplug and Recharge

Treehouse Retreat in Asheville, North Carolina

Tucked away in the Blue Ridge Mountains, this solar-powered treehouse retreat blends rustic charm with eco-conscious living. Surrounded by forest and far from city lights, it’s a dreamy escape for couples or solo travelers who want to reconnect with nature.

  • Solar-powered, Wi-Fi-free experience
  • Nearby hiking trails and waterfalls
  • Cozy yet modern amenities

Desert Dome in Joshua Tree, California

Escape to the Mojave Desert with a stay in an off-grid geodesic dome. Just outside Joshua Tree National Park, this getaway offers stunning sunrises, star-filled skies, and a minimalist lifestyle.

  • No Wi-Fi or TV, just open skies
  • Close to hiking, bouldering, and nature tours
  • Solar-powered with a composting toilet

Secluded Cabin in Talkeetna, Alaska

If you’re looking to get truly remote, this Alaskan log cabin offers breathtaking views of Denali and no neighbors for miles. It’s a perfect digital detox for adventurers.

  • No cell service or internet
  • Wildlife sightings, northern lights, and river views
  • Fully equipped with a wood stove and natural spring water

Eco-Lodge on the Big Island, Hawaii

Nestled in the rainforest near Volcanoes National Park, this eco-lodge operates completely off-grid using solar power and rainwater catchment. Expect lush surroundings and the calming sounds of native birds.

  • Organic meals and sustainable practices
  • Outdoor showers with volcanic rock walls
  • Ideal for eco-conscious travelers

Remote Yurt in Taos, New Mexico

This high-desert yurt sits at the base of the Sangre de Cristo Mountains and offers panoramic views with absolute silence. With no electricity or running water, it’s a step back in time on purpose.

  • Stargazing and spiritual solitude
  • Wood-fired stove and oil lanterns
  • Close to Taos art and cultural experiences

Island Cabin in Ontario, Canada

Accessible only by boat, this cabin on a private island in northern Ontario is as off-grid as it gets. No Wi-Fi, no traffic, just water, trees, and wildlife.

  • Fully solar-powered with lakefront views
  • Kayaking, fishing, and campfire cooking
  • Perfect for digital detoxes and nature immersion

Why Off-the-Grid Travel Is Worth It

Stepping away from technology and noise isn’t just refreshing; it can improve mental clarity, reduce stress, and deepen your connection with the natural world. Off-the-grid getaways aren’t about sacrificing comfort but about embracing simplicity and mindful travel.

How to Prepare for an Off-Grid Trip

  • Pack a physical map or compass
  • Bring extra batteries or solar chargers
  • Prepare for minimal cell service and no internet
  • Let someone know your location and return time
  • Embrace the slower pace and limited distractions

Frequently Asked Questions

What does “off-the-grid” mean for travelers?

It typically refers to accommodations without internet, cell service, or modern infrastructure like municipal power and water.

Are off-grid getaways safe?

Yes, but it’s important to research, prepare, and follow local guidance. Many places provide basic safety tools and host support nearby.

Can I bring kids to an off-grid retreat?

Some locations are family-friendly, while others are better suited for solo or adult-only trips. Check the listing carefully before booking.

Do off-the-grid places have toilets and showers?

Many do, though some may have composting toilets or outdoor showers. Amenities vary, so always check in advance.
